Vitra

Vitra is a Swiss company dedicated to improving the quality of homes, offices and public spaces through the power of design. The Vitra collection boasts many iconic products by renowned designers, like the Lounge Chair by Ray & Charles Eames and the Panton Chair named after Verner Panton himself. The brand’s different styles demonstrate its versatility: each individual designer has his or her own design signature.

    Designed by Charles and Ray Eames in 1950, the Plastic Chair was the first of it's kind being mass produced. DAL stands for polished aluminium "La Fonda" base, which was developed as well by the couple for the restaurant La Fonda del Sol, in New York, as a request from Alexander Girard.     New, unused EA117 operating chair with black Netwave canvas finish designed by Charles and Ray Eames for Vitra, the aluminium group swivel chairs can add an iconic presence to any office environment. These chairs are equipped with a tilt mechanism that can be adjusted according to the user's weight to ensure optimum comfort and can also be adjusted in height. In addition, the chairs are known for their lightweight aluminium frame and flexible seat and back that adapt to the user's body.     Spatio is a meeting and dining table created by the award-winning Italian designer Antonio Citterio for Vitra in the 90s, reflecting its functional and sophisticated style. With a rectangular solid oak top and a chrome-plated aluminium frame, this piece combines timeless elegance and robustness, making it perfect for both corporate spaces and contemporary residential interiors. The formal simplicity of Spatio and the quality of the materials translate the best of European design of the 90s, offering a table versatile, durable and minimalist aesthetic, able to integrate harmoniously in different environments.     The Eames Segmented Table is a remarkable example of the functional and elegant design created by the legendary couple Charles & Ray Eames in 1964. Developed with a modular system of segmented bases, this table allows you to create various formats and dimensions, easily adapting to both corporate meeting rooms and contemporary collaborative spaces. Thanks to its versatile structure, the table can be equipped with electrical connections, data inputs and wireless charging technology, with all cabling discreetly hidden in the base columns, ensuring a clean and sophisticated aesthetic. More than a functional piece, the Eames Segmented Table reflects the design legacy of the 20th century, combining technical innovation, durability and timeless elegance, values that continue to define the Vitra universe.     The Butterfly Bench, created by iconic Japanese designer Sori Yanagi, is a piece that combines oriental craftsmanship tradition and western industrial innovation. Its elegant silhouette, formed by two moulded wooden shells that open like butterfly wings about to take flight, has made it a classic of post-war design. Produced in maple or rosewood, this bench is a perfect example of the fusion between poetic simplicity and technical sophistication, resulting from the adaptation of the plywood molding technique developed by Charles and Ray Eames to the Japanese aesthetic universe.     The Panton Chair, designed by visionary Danish designer Verner Panton, is an absolute icon of 20th century design. Developed in collaboration with Vitra, it was the first integral plastic chair produced in a single piece with cantilever structure, marking a revolution in modern furniture. Internationally recognized, the Panton Chair has won numerous design awards and is part of the collections of the world’s leading museums. Its organic and sculptural shape combines bold aesthetics with ergonomic comfort, making it ideal for contemporary and creative environments. It is suitable for temporary outdoor use, provided that protected after prolonged exposure, ensuring durability and preservation of its iconic appearance. More than a chair, the Panton Chair is a piece of collection that translates the boldness and innovation of the design of the 60s, remaining timeless and desired to this day.     MedaSlim Chair, fully black, with armrests, designed by Alberto Meda for Vitra, is a robust universal chair that offers exceptional comfort. Elegant and modern chair can be used wherever you need it with a comfortable seat and for long periods. The flexible structure of the backrest, seat and front legs are moulded into a single piece and adapt to the movements of the user’s body.     A true piece of modernist design, the Chair DSR (Dining Side Rod base) stands out for its delicate and structurally robust metal base - known as "Eiffel Tower" - that gives visual lightness without compromising stability. The ergonomic shell in post-consumer recycled plastic adapts naturally to the body and gains additional comfort with the integrated soft seat, offering a more welcoming user experience. Combining functionality, sustainability and timeless aesthetics, this icon designed by Charles & Ray Eames for Vitra continues to be a sophisticated choice for both residential and professional environments.
